The Future of Transactions : Why Small Businesses Are Embracing Contactless
Wiki Article
Small businesses throughout the country are rapidly adopting contactless EFTPOS payments. This shift is driven by a range of factors, including customer demand for safe transactions and the ease of using mobile devices technology.
Furthermore, contactless payments offer businesses to process transactions faster, reducing queues and boosting customer satisfaction.
- Contactless EFTPOS provides a reliable payment option.
- Merchants can complete transactions efficiently.
- Customers appreciate the speed of contactless payments.
As technology continues to evolve, contactless EFTPOS is poised to become the preferred payment method for small businesses, providing a seamless and enjoyable customer experience.

The Rise of Digital Wallets : Trends Driving Australia's Cashless Economy
Australia embraces quickly transitioning to a cashless society, with digital wallets becoming an increasingly prevalent choice for consumers. This move is driven by several significant trends. Firstly, the simplicity of using digital wallets has stimulated widespread adoption. With just a few clicks on a smartphone, users can make transactions quickly and securely. Moreover, governments and businesses are actively promoting the use of digital wallets through incentives and schemes. This has helped to foster public confidence in these technologies.
Finally, the growing adoption of contactless payments has accelerated the rise of Customer Behaviour Trends in a Cashless Economy digital wallets. As more retailers accept contactless payments, consumers are increasingly choosing digital wallets as their go-to payment method.
